Назад | Перейти на главную страницу

Ошибки Gluster и поврежденные разрешения

Сегодня мы столкнулись со странной ошибкой при использовании gluster.

Журнал блеска был полон

  [2016-04-18 03:54:32.164587] W [fuse-bridge.c:462:fuse_entry_cbk] 0-glusterfs-fuse: 128: LOOKUP() /jobs/infrastructure/config.xml => -1 (Input/output error)

В то время как разрешения, пользователь и группа были полны вопросительных знаков.

Интересно, что установка была частично функциональной, так как я мог создавать файлы и каталоги с одного клиента и видеть их с другого, но не наоборот.

Мы подозреваем, что это было что-то вроде состояния расщепления мозга, которое могло быть вызвано рассинхронизацией часов. Примечательно, что серверы находились в разных часовых поясах, поэтому разница была в часах. Выполнение команд обнаружения разделенного мозга на сервере не дало никаких интересных результатов.

Есть какие-нибудь предположения о том, что могло вызвать это?

Единственным / самым быстрым решением было регенерировать кирпич, перемонтировать и скопировать из резервной копии. Приветствуются любые альтернативные решения.